Prof Gavin Bridge is a resource and economic geographer at the University of Durham, whose research focuses on the extractive industries of gas, mining and oil. His work spans questions related to political ecology of resource scarcity and security, new geographies of resource production/consumption, global production of raw materials, and geographies of energy transition and governance. Gavin is also the co-author of the recently published book ‘Oil’ with Philippe Le Billon.
This keynote speech is part of the Interdisciplinary Conference on Extraction & Exclusion.
